Visual Excellence with LED Wall Technology
Traditional projection technology often struggles in bright Calgary venues, particularly those with significant natural light like the glass-walled spaces in downtown hotels. High-resolution LED walls have become the gold standard because they offer superior brightness and contrast that projectors cannot match. When evaluating a partner, ask about their pixel pitch capabilities. A tighter pixel pitch ensures that even attendees in the front row see a crisp, seamless image without visible pixels. The Risk of Relying Solely on Venue AV
Many Calgary venues offer "in-house" AV packages. While convenient, these often come with significant limitations. In-house gear is frequently older, and the staff may be generalists rather than specialized engineers. You might also encounter tiered pricing that adds up quickly for basic upgrades, often exceeding the cost of a dedicated production team. An independent production partner prioritizes your specific technical needs over the venue's profit margins. Verify equipment ownership early in the conversation. When a company owns its LED walls and audio systems, they have total control over maintenance and configuration. Sub-renting often introduces hidden costs and technical inconsistencies that you simply can't afford in a live environment.
On-site management is another critical factor. A lead production manager should be your single point of contact, coordinating every technical move from the first cable pull to the final load-out. This person manages the frequency coordination needed to prevent wireless microphone interference in the RF-heavy downtown core. They also ensure all temporary structures meet the City of Calgary's strict safety codes. This includes managing the necessary building permits, which must be submitted at least 45 days before your event date to remain compliant with local regulations.
Vetting Technical Expertise
Ask potential partners about their approach to audio-visual signal redundancy. A professional firm always has a "Plan B" for critical signal paths, ensuring that a single equipment failure doesn't stop the show. Request a technical site visit at your chosen Calgary venue to see how they plan to handle specific acoustic or visual challenges. Ensure they provide dedicated technicians for every department. You need a specialist for audio, another for video, and a lead for lighting. One person trying to manage all three is a recipe for technical failure. How much does corporate event production cost in Calgary?
Technical production costs in 2026 are determined by the scale and complexity of the hardware required. Industry estimates for general sessions often range from $25,000 for single-room setups to over $350,000 for multi-day conferences or high-profile product launches. These costs reflect the inventory of LED walls, audio coverage needs, and the number of dedicated technicians on-site.

What is the lead time for booking a production company for a Calgary event?
Standard lead times depend on the complexity of your technical requirements. For large-scale conferences, it's recommended to book your partner 6 to 12 months in advance. Mid-size corporate events usually require 3 to 6 months of lead time to ensure equipment availability and to complete necessary technical site visits at your chosen venue.
